Navigating the Course: Choosing the Right Career Path In You

Choosing a career path is a pivotal decision that can profoundly impact your life's journey. It requires careful consideration, introspection, and a willingness to explore various options. Begin by pinpointing your passions, skills, and values. Reflect what truly motivates you and where your talents lie.

Research different career fields that align with your interests and gauge the required education, experience, and trajectory. Network with professionals in your field of interest to gain valuable insights and perspectives. Remember, your career path is not set in stone. It's a journey that can evolve and transform over time. Be open to new opportunities and continuously hone your skills to stay relevant in a dynamic job market.

  • Employ online resources, career counseling services, and informational interviews to gather comprehensive information about different career paths.
  • Develop a strong resume and construct compelling cover letters that highlight your relevant skills and experiences.
  • Network actively with professionals in your field of interest to build valuable connections and explore potential opportunities.

Ultimately, the key to successful career navigation lies in a combination of self-awareness, proactive planning, and a willingness to embrace lifelong learning.
